Mimics Action 500 is a 1995 Indian Malayalam comedy film, directed by Balu Kiriyath and produced by Harikumaran Thampi. The film stars Rajan P. Dev, KPAC Lalitha, A. C. Zainuddin and Abi in the lead roles. The film has musical score by S. P. Venkatesh.[1][2][3]

Soundtrack[edit]

The music was composed by S. P. Venkatesh and the lyrics were written by Gireesh Puthenchery.

No. Song Singers Lyrics Length (m:ss)
1 "Chellappoo Chamayappoo" Biju Narayanan, Chorus Gireesh Puthenchery
2 "Mamalakkaranam" Biju Narayanan, Pradeep Gireesh Puthenchery
3 "Manimala Mettil" K. S. Chithra, Biju Narayanan, Pradeep Gireesh Puthenchery
